Saturday Race Selection: Grade III West Virginia Derby

By Rick Francis —-

Mountaineer Race Track

Race 8) Grade 3 West Virginia Derby 3yo 1&1/8th Miles Post Time 5:35 EDT

Lionite (1), Asmussen/Cabrera; after running near the rear, Quality Road colt was closing late last out in the Iowa Derby; likes to be forwardly placed, so he needs to stay out of trouble early.

Draft Pick (2), Eurton/Talamo; Grade 3 Affirmed winner was caught in the closing strides last out in the Los Alamitos Derby; he’s put together three straight strong efforts; obvious win threat.

Caloric (3), Londono/Mejias; colt hasn’t been competitive in his last four starts.

King Cause (4), O’Neill/Leparoux; the jock change to Leparoux can’t hurt, but this gelding has yet to prove he fits with these.

Once On Whiskey (5), Baffert/Prat; in his first real distance test last out in the Los Al, Bodemeister colt had enough to get the win; Baffert with a last out winner, 34 percent; you know what you’re getting with this one.

Rugbyman (6), Motion/Vargas; after a game neck second two back in the Easy Goer, Tapit colt just didn’t have it in the Grade 3 Dwyer where he finished a very distant fourth. He’s got the skills, but this is a tough spot to rebound.

Pamir (7), Vashchenko/Quinones; broke his maiden here in May and exits a solid second here as well, just on the turf course; overmatched.

Mr Freeze (8), Romans/Albarado; he was closing fast in the Iowa Derby, his second straight late running effort; give him another sensible pace to chase, and he’s got a legit shot.

High North (9), Cox/Geroux; given a ground saving trip, colt out of Midnight Lute was asked in the Iowa Derby stretch and he responded winning by a half-length. The Brad Cox barn has been one of the hottest all year, this guy will show up again in here.

Selections: 9, 2, 5, 8
